4.4.2. Status Word under Instances 20/70 and 21/71
The status word in Instances 70 and 71 is de-
fined in the overview to the right:
Explanation of the Bits:
Bit 0, Fault:
Bit 0 = "0" means that there is no fault in the frequency converter.
Bit 0 = "1" means that there is a fault in the frequency converter.
Bit 1, Warning:
Bit 0 = "0" means that there is no unusual situation.
Bit 0 = "1" means that an abnormal condition has arisen.
Bit 2, Running 1:
Bit 2 = "0" means that the drive is not in one of these states or that Run 1 is not set.
Bit 2 = "1" means that the drive state attribute is enabled or stopping, or that Fault-Stop and bit
0 (Run 1) of the control word are set at the same time.
Bit 3, Running 2:
Bit 3 = "0" means that the drive is in neither of these states or that Run 2 is not set.
Bit 3 = "1" means that the drive state attribute is enabled or stopping, or that fault-stop and bit
0 (Run 2) of the control word are set at the same time.
Bit 4, Ready:
Bit 4 = "0" means that the state attribute is in another state.
Bit 4 = "1" means that the state attribute is ready, enabled or stopping.
Bit 5, Control from net:
Bit 5 = "0" means that the drive is controlled from the standard inputs.
Bit 5 = "1" means that DeviceNet has control (start, stop, reverse) of the drive.
NB!
Note that the bits 00 and 02 in Instance 70 are identical with bits 00 and 02 in the
more extensive Instance 71.
